I have performed a number of tests on my LaCie 1TB SSD using thunderbolt and the result is, well, disappointing.
I received a lot of help from Dr-Kiev during these tests.

Posting them here for you guys thinking of doing the same thing.


Basically what you see from the images is that the Mac OS RAID software is soooo much more efficient than Windows RAID. Look at images filenames for info.
So if you consider software RAIDING your SSD disks with Windows, dont, because its not much faster than a single SSD (and with the added risk of data loss compared to not much improved speed, not worth it)

I am gonna find a Hardware Controller and conduct more tests :)


I also added the tests from my 1 TB Internal Fusion Drive (and you can clearly see that Windows Bootcamp does not support Fusion Drive)
